Lip Filler cost in Raleigh
Typical pricing per syringe. Local prices vary by provider and how much treatment you need.
| Range | Price per syringe |
|---|---|
| Lower end | $600 |
| Average | $900 |
| Higher end | $1,200 |
What to know about lip filler
Hyaluronic acid filler to add subtle volume, shape, and definition to the lips.
- What it treats
- lips
- Typical sessions
- 1 session, lasts 6–12 months
- Downtime
- 1–3 days of swelling
- Average cost
- $600–$1,200 per syringe
Lip Filler in Raleigh: FAQs
How much does lip filler cost in Raleigh?
Pricing in Raleigh varies by provider, but lip filler generally costs around $600–$1,200 per syringe based on national averages. Factors like the provider's experience, the products used, and how much treatment you need all affect the final price. Always confirm pricing during a consultation.
How many sessions of lip filler will I need?
1 session, lasts 6–12 months. Your provider will recommend a plan based on your goals and how your skin or body responds.
Is there any downtime after lip filler?
Typical downtime is: 1–3 days of swelling. Your provider will give you specific aftercare guidance for your situation.
How do I choose a lip filler provider in Raleigh?
Look for licensed, experienced practitioners, ask who performs the treatment and their training, read recent reviews, and book a consultation first. A good provider sets realistic expectations and answers your questions without pressure.
